Botox and dermal fillers are among the most well-known cosmetic procedures. They are minimally invasive and offer quick results, making them a popular choice for those looking to reduce the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ines. These treatments can be administered in a short office visit, with little to no downtime, allowing individuals to resume their daily activities almost immediately.

Botox works by temporarily paralyzing the muscles responsible for wrinkles, particularly around the forehead and eyes. The result is smoother skin with fewer visible lines. Botox is often used for crow’s feet, frown lines, and forehead wrinkles. The effects of Botox can last for several months, after which follow-up treatments can maintain the desired appearance.

Botox not only provides cosmetic benefits but also has therapeutic applications. It can be used to treat medical conditions such as chronic migraines and excessive sweating, showcasing its versatility. As one of the most researched and trusted treatments, Botox continues to be a leading choice for those seeking to rejuvenate their appearance without undergoing surgery.

Dermal fillers, on the other hand, add volume to areas of the face that have lost fullness due to aging. They are commonly used to plump lips, enhance cheekbones, and reduce nasolabial folds. The results are immediate and can last from several months to over a year, depending on the type of filler used. Different types of fillers, such as hyaluronic acid and collagen-based fillers, offer varying benefits tailored to individual needs.

In addition to facial volume restoration, dermal fillers can also be used to improve the appearance of scars and redefine the contours of the face. The procedure is quick and relatively painless, with results that can be customized to achieve a natural-looking enhancement. As a non-surgical option, dermal fillers provide a flexible solution for those seeking to maintain youthful features without the need for invasive procedures.

Chemical peels are another popular option for skin rejuvenation. This procedure involves applying a chemical solution to the skin, which causes the top layer to exfoliate and peel off. The new skin that emerges is typically smoother and less wrinkled. Chemical peels can be customized to target specific skin concerns, making them a versatile choice for individuals seeking to improve their complexion.

Chemical peels can address various skin issues, including acne scars, sun damage, and uneven skin tone. They come in different strengths, ranging from mild to deep peels, depending on the desired outcome and skin type. Mild peels offer subtle improvements with minimal downtime, while deeper peels provide more dramatic results but may require a longer recovery period. By selecting the appropriate peel, individuals can achieve their desired level of skin rejuvenation with precision.

Laser skin resurfacing is a highly effective treatment for improving skin texture and appearance. It uses concentrated beams of light to remove damaged skin layers, promoting the growth of new, healthy skin. This advanced procedure can be tailored to address specific concerns and is suitable for a wide range of skin types.

This procedure can treat a range of issues, including acne scars, age spots, and fine lines. The recovery time varies depending on the intensity of the treatment, but the results are typically long-lasting. With advancements in laser technology, treatments have become more precise and gentle, minimizing discomfort and downtime. Laser skin resurfacing offers a powerful solution for those seeking to achieve a smoother, more youthful complexion.

Microdermabrasion is a gentle exfoliation technique that removes the outer layer of dead skin cells. It uses a special device that sprays fine crystals onto the skin, which are then vacuumed away along with the dead cells. This non-invasive procedure is ideal for individuals seeking to improve their skin’s appearance with minimal recovery time.

This procedure is ideal for those looking to improve skin texture and tone with minimal downtime. It can help reduce the appearance of minor scars, sun damage, and enlarged pores. Microdermabrasion can be performed as a standalone treatment or in combination with other procedures to enhance overall results. Regular sessions can help maintain a radiant complexion and prevent the buildup of dead skin cells, promoting a healthy glow.

Microneedling, also known as collagen induction therapy, involves using a device with fine needles to create tiny punctures in the skin. This process stimulates the body’s natural healing response, promoting collagen production and skin rejuvenation. By enhancing the skin’s natural repair processes, microneedling can deliver impressive improvements in skin tone and texture.

Microneedling can improve the appearance of scars, fine lines, and large pores. It’s a versatile procedure that can be combined with other treatments, such as PRP (platelet-rich plasma) therapy, for enhanced results. The treatment is well-tolerated and suitable for most skin types, making it a popular choice among individuals seeking comprehensive skin improvement. With regular sessions, microneedling can help maintain a youthful and vibrant appearance.

Selecting the right cosmetic dermatology procedure depends on various factors, including your skin type, concerns, and desired outcome. It’s essential to consult with a qualified dermatologist who can assess your skin and recommend the most suitable treatments. A personalized approach ensures that you receive the best possible care and achieve optimal results.

Before deciding on a procedure, consider the following:

  • Downtime: Some procedures require more recovery time than others. Consider your schedule and how much downtime you can accommodate. Balancing your lifestyle with the recovery demands of a treatment is crucial for a smooth experience.
  • Cost: Cosmetic procedures can vary in price. Ensure you have a clear understanding of the costs involved. Discuss payment options and potential financing plans with your dermatologist to make the process more manageable.
  • Risks: While most cosmetic dermatology procedures are safe, it’s important to be aware of potential risks and side effects. Research each procedure thoroughly and ask your dermatologist about any concerns you may have.
  • Results: Understand that results can vary based on individual factors. Have realistic expectations about what the procedure can achieve. Setting clear goals with your dermatologist can help align your expectations with achievable outcomes.

Once you’ve undergone a cosmetic dermatology procedure, it’s crucial to maintain your skin’s health to prolong the results. Here are some tips:

  • Follow Post-Procedure Instructions: Your dermatologist will provide specific aftercare instructions. Follow them diligently to ensure proper healing. Adhering to these guidelines can prevent complications and enhance the effectiveness of the treatment.
  • Use Sunscreen: Protect your skin from sun damage by applying a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30 daily. Sun protection is vital in preserving the results and preventing further skin damage.
  •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water to keep your skin hydrated and support its natural healing processes. Adequate hydration helps maintain skin elasticity and promotes a healthy complexion.
  • Adopt a Skincare Routine: Maintain a regular skincare routine that includes cleansing, moisturizing, and using products suitable for your skin type. A consistent regimen can help sustain the improvements gained from cosmetic procedures.
